Transaction 73ea32b1986603f5d6bb0b491d8bddaabc425f82f0c88c6029077a9c0b4b893d

1 Input
2 Outputs
  • 73ea32b1986603f5d6bb0b491d8bddaabc425f82f0c88c6029077a9c0b4b893d:0
  • value  1529956
    address  3BMEXpBnG8cmvvWrH9WEYH35uAArXQympN
  • 73ea32b1986603f5d6bb0b491d8bddaabc425f82f0c88c6029077a9c0b4b893d:1
  • value  4272278
    address  1Efw8vS7WFdMFjyCX6p4zahdqr9qhL88Uf